What Are the Key Features of the Best Portable Water Flosser?

The key features of the best portable water flosser include:

  • Compact Design: A portable water flosser should be lightweight and easy to carry, making it ideal for travel and storage in small spaces.
  • Rechargeable Battery: The best models come with a long-lasting rechargeable battery that allows for multiple uses on a single charge, ensuring convenience while on the go.
  • Multiple Pressure Settings: Adjustable pressure settings provide users with the ability to customize their flossing experience, catering to sensitive gums or specific cleaning needs.
  • Water Reservoir Capacity: A sufficient water reservoir is crucial for uninterrupted use; portable models should balance size with the ability to hold enough water for effective cleaning.
  • Ease of Use: Simple controls and ergonomic designs enhance usability, allowing users to easily maneuver the device while flossing.
  • Durability and Water Resistance: A robust construction and water-resistant features ensure the flosser can withstand regular use and moisture, making it a reliable travel companion.

Compact Design: The best portable water flossers are designed to be compact and lightweight, allowing for easy transportation whether for travel or everyday use. This feature makes them convenient to fit into bags without taking up much space.

Rechargeable Battery: Long-lasting rechargeable batteries are essential in portable models, providing the freedom to use the flosser without being tethered to a power source. Many high-quality portable flossers can last for several days on a single charge, making them practical for travel.

Multiple Pressure Settings: Having several pressure settings is beneficial, as it allows users to select the intensity that best suits their comfort level, especially for those with sensitive gums. This versatility makes the flosser suitable for a wider range of users.

Water Reservoir Capacity: A larger water reservoir can facilitate longer flossing sessions without the need to refill constantly, but it should still maintain a portable size. Striking a balance between capacity and compactness is crucial for effective use.

Ease of Use: User-friendly controls and an ergonomic design are important features that enhance the flossing experience. A well-designed portable flosser should be easy to operate, even for those who may be new to water flossing.

Durability and Water Resistance: The best portable water flossers are built to withstand the rigors of travel, with durable materials and water-resistant designs that prevent damage from moisture. This ensures longevity and reliability for frequent users.

How Do You Use a Portable Water Flosser Effectively?

Using a portable water flosser effectively involves several key steps to ensure optimal oral hygiene.

  • Read the Instructions: Familiarize yourself with the manufacturer’s guidelines before using the device.
  • Fill the Reservoir: Use lukewarm water to fill the reservoir for comfort and effectiveness.
  • Select the Right Pressure Setting: Start with a lower pressure setting to avoid discomfort, especially if you’re new to water flossing.
  • Position the Tip Correctly: Aim the flosser tip at the gum line at a 90-degree angle to ensure effective cleaning.
  • Use a Systematic Approach: Move the flosser around your mouth systematically, covering all areas including between teeth and along the gum line.
  • Practice Good Timing: Spend at least 30 seconds on each quadrant of your mouth to ensure thorough cleaning.
  • Clean the Device After Use: Rinse the water reservoir and clean the tip to maintain hygiene and prolong the lifespan of the flosser.

Reading the instructions is vital as each model may have unique features or operational methods. Proper understanding helps prevent misuse and maximizes the effectiveness of the water flosser.

Filling the reservoir with lukewarm water enhances comfort, as cold water can be shocking to sensitive gums while hot water may damage the device. The right temperature ensures a pleasant and effective flossing experience.

Selecting the right pressure setting is crucial; starting low allows your gums to acclimate to the sensation of water flossing. Gradually increase the pressure to find a comfortable level that effectively removes plaque without causing discomfort.

Positioning the tip at a 90-degree angle to the gum line is essential for maximizing the cleaning power of the flosser. This angle ensures that the water jet effectively dislodges food particles and plaque from both teeth and gums.

Using a systematic approach means covering every part of your mouth, which is important for comprehensive cleaning. Make sure to target areas that are often missed, such as the back teeth and between teeth where plaque tends to accumulate.

Practicing good timing ensures that you dedicate enough time to each quadrant of your mouth, which is necessary for effective cleaning. Aim for at least 30 seconds per section to achieve optimal results.

Finally, cleaning the device after each use is important for maintaining oral hygiene and extending the life of the flosser. Rinsing the reservoir and sanitizing the tip prevents bacterial buildup and keeps your water flosser ready for effective use.

What Maintenance Practices Extend the Lifespan of Your Portable Water Flosser?

Several maintenance practices can significantly extend the lifespan of your portable water flosser.

  • Regular Cleaning: It is essential to clean the water flosser regularly to prevent buildup of bacteria and mineral deposits. Rinsing the reservoir and nozzle with warm soapy water after each use helps maintain hygiene and functionality.
  • Descaling: Over time, minerals from water can accumulate inside the unit, affecting performance. Using a descaling solution or a mixture of white vinegar and water every few months can help remove these deposits and keep the flosser running smoothly.
  • Proper Storage: Storing the water flosser in a dry and cool place when not in use can prevent damage and prolong its life. Avoid exposing the device to extreme temperatures or humidity, which can weaken the components.
  • Battery Maintenance: If your portable water flosser is battery-operated, it’s important to foll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for charging and storage. Avoid letting the battery fully discharge frequently, as this can shorten its lifespan.
  • Regular Inspection: Periodically check the flosser for any signs of wear or damage, such as cracks in the reservoir or frayed power cords. Addressing any issues early can prevent more significant problems down the line and ensure consistent performance.
